Is High-Density Polyethylene Cheap?

Yes, High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E) is considered a cost-effective material. HDPE is a type of plastic that is widely used in various industries due to its affordability, versatility, and durability.

The low cost of HDPE can be attributed to several factors. Firstly, it is made from petroleum, which is a commonly available and relatively inexpensive raw material. This makes the production of HDPE more affordable compared to other plastics such as polycarbonate or polypropylene.

In addition, the manufacturing process of HDPE is relatively simple and efficient, leading to lower production costs. The polymerization of ethylene, the main component of HDPE, can be carried out using different techniques, including high-pressure and low-pressure processes. The high-pressure process is more economical and commonly used, resulting in cheaper production costs.

Furthermore, HDPE's durability plays a significant role in its affordability. It has excellent resistance to chemicals, moisture, UV radiation, and impact. This durability makes HDPE suitable for a wide range of applications, reducing the need for frequent replacements. Compared to other materials such as metals or glass, HDPE is much more cost-effective in the long run due to its longevity and low maintenance requirements.

Another reason for the cost-effectiveness of HDPE is its recyclability. HDPE products can be easily recycled and transformed into other useful products, reducing the demand for virgin materials. The recycling process for HDPE is relatively energy-efficient, making it an environmentally friendly option. The availability of recycled HDPE contributes to its affordability as it reduces the need for new material production.

The low cost of HDPE has significant implications and impacts on various industries. In the packaging industry, for example, HDPE is commonly used for bottles, containers, and bags due to its low cost and resistance to chemicals. This helps manufacturers minimize production costs and offer affordable products to consumers. Additionally, its use in construction, agriculture, and automotive industries provides durable and cost-effective solutions for various applications.

Furthermore, the affordability of HDPE plays a crucial role in waste management practices. The use of HDPE for products such as trash cans and recycling bins promotes proper waste disposal and recycling. These products are more accessible to the general public due to their low cost, encouraging responsible waste management practices and contributing to a cleaner environment.

In conclusion, High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E) is indeed a cost-effective material. Its low cost can be attributed to the abundance of petroleum, efficient manufacturing processes, durability, and recyclability. The affordability of HDPE has significant implications and influences various industries, including packaging, construction, and waste management. Its versatility and cost-effectiveness make it a preferred choice for many applications.
